How to Submit BEE-001 assignments
The submission process for BEE-001 assignments typically involves submitting the handwritten responses to the Coordinator of your allotted Study Centre. Before submitting, ensure that you have attached the standard IGNOU assignment front page which includes your enrollment number, name, address, and study centre code clearly. It is highly recommended to keep a photocopy or a scanned PDF of your completed work for future reference.
In some cases, Regional Centres may allow online submission through a dedicated Google Form or an LMS portal. You must check the official website of your specific Regional Centre to confirm whether they require physical hard copies or digital uploads. Always obtain a submission receipt from the study centre, as this serves as proof of submission in case there are delays in updating the BEE-001 assignment status on the official portal.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q1: What is the passing mark for BEE-001 assignment?
Students must score at least 40% (or 50% depending on specific programme guidelines) to pass the assignment component. Failure to pass the assignment will prevent you from clearing the overall course even if you pass the theory exam.
Q2: Can I submit the BEE-001 assignment after the deadline?
Generally, IGNOU does not accept assignments after the officially announced last date. However, the university often grants extensions. You must stay updated with the official notifications on the IGNOU main website regarding deadline extensions.
Q3: Is it necessary to submit the assignments before the TEE?
Yes, submitting the BEE-001 assignments is a prerequisite for appearing in the Term-End Examination. If you have not submitted your assignments, your results for the theory papers may be withheld or shown as incomplete.
Q4: How can I check my assignment submission status?
You can check your submission status on the IGNOU Assignment Status portal by entering your 9 or 10-digit enrollment number. Note that it usually takes 40 to 60 days after submission for the status to be updated online.
Q5: What should I do if my BEE-001 assignment marks are not updated?
If your marks are not updated within a reasonable timeframe, you should contact your Study Centre Coordinator with your submission receipt. You may also reach out to the Student Evaluation Division (SED) at Maidan Garhi for further assistance.
